{
  "v": "2.0",
  "page_type": "product",
  "title": "SwissGear Top-Loading Black Messenger Bag | Grand &amp; Toy",
  "breadcrumbs": [
    {
      "label": "Home",
      "href": "/python/html5/index.html"
    },
    {
      "label": "Brands",
      "href": "/python/html5/menu_brand_index/menu_brand_index_brands_87101ba214.html"
    },
    {
      "label": "SwissGear",
      "href": "/python/html5/menu_brand_products/1000/3000/menu_brand_products_SwissGear_1_7ff0043637.html"
    },
    {
      "label": "SWA0953D",
      "href": null
    }
  ],
  "content": {
    "product": {
      "mpn": "SWA0953D",
      "manufacturer": "SwissGear",
      "brand": "SwissGear",
      "brand_url": "/python/html5/menu_brand_products/1000/3000/menu_brand_products_SwissGear_1_7ff0043637.html",
      "title": "SwissGear Top-Loading Black Messenger Bag | Grand &amp; Toy",
      "description": "",
      "attributes": [
        {
          "name": "Brand name",
          "values": [
            {
              "value": "SwissGear",
              "url": "/python/html5/menu_attr_pair/1000/2000000/2279000/menu_attr_pair_Brandname_SwissGear_1_3e4a3707da.html"
            }
          ],
          "name_url": "/python/html5/menu_attr_pair/1000/2000000/2279000/menu_attr_pair_Brandname_SwissGear_1_3e4a3707da.html"
        },
        {
          "name": "Manufacturer name",
          "values": [
            {
              "value": "SwissGear",
              "url": "/python/html5/menu_attr_pair/1000/2000000/2279000/menu_attr_pair_Manufacturername_SwissGear_1_386a20e0a5.html"
            }
          ],
          "name_url": "/python/html5/menu_attr_pair/1000/2000000/2279000/menu_attr_pair_Manufacturername_SwissGear_1_386a20e0a5.html"
        },
        {
          "name": "Manufacturer",
          "values": [
            {
              "value": "SwissGear",
              "url": "/python/html5/menu_attr_pair/1000/2000000/2279000/menu_attr_pair_Manufacturer_SwissGear_1_61b26b8fb5.html"
            }
          ],
          "name_url": "/python/html5/menu_attr_pair/1000/2000000/2279000/menu_attr_pair_Manufacturer_SwissGear_1_61b26b8fb5.html"
        },
        {
          "name": "KnownMan",
          "values": [
            {
              "value": "SwissGear Top-Loading Black Messenger Bag | Grand &amp; Toy",
              "url": "/python/html5/menu_attr_pair/1000/2000000/2287000/menu_attr_pair_KnownMan_SwissGearTopLoadingBlackMessengerBagGranda_1_b1a0667c2f.html"
            }
          ],
          "name_url": "/python/html5/menu_attr_pair/1000/2000000/2287000/menu_attr_pair_KnownMan_SwissGearTopLoadingBlackMessengerBagGranda_1_b1a0667c2f.html"
        },
        {
          "name": "Extra Product Name",
          "values": [
            {
              "value": "SwissGear Top-Loading Black Messenger Bag | Grand &amp; Toy",
              "url": "/python/html5/menu_attr_pair/1000/2000000/2287000/menu_attr_pair_ExtraProductName_SwissGearTopLoadingBlackMessengerBagGranda_1_f4b2c31a9d.html"
            }
          ],
          "name_url": "/python/html5/menu_attr_pair/1000/2000000/2287000/menu_attr_pair_ExtraProductName_SwissGearTopLoadingBlackMessengerBagGranda_1_f4b2c31a9d.html"
        },
        {
          "name": "moq",
          "values": [
            {
              "value": "1",
              "url": "/python/html5/menu_attr_pair/menu_attr_pair_moq_1_1_29ca727a89.html"
            }
          ],
          "name_url": "/python/html5/menu_attr_pair/menu_attr_pair_moq_1_1_29ca727a89.html"
        },
        {
          "name": "MPN",
          "values": [
            {
              "value": "SWA0953D",
              "url": "/python/html5/menu_attr_pair/1000/2000000/2287000/menu_attr_pair_MPN_SWA0953D_1_8141726c8b.html"
            }
          ],
          "name_url": "/python/html5/menu_attr_pair/1000/2000000/2287000/menu_attr_pair_MPN_SWA0953D_1_8141726c8b.html"
        },
        {
          "name": "multiple",
          "values": [
            {
              "value": "1",
              "url": "/python/html5/menu_attr_pair/menu_attr_pair_multiple_1_1_2f60c1bab8.html"
            }
          ],
          "name_url": "/python/html5/menu_attr_pair/menu_attr_pair_multiple_1_1_2f60c1bab8.html"
        },
        {
          "name": "qtyInStock",
          "values": [
            {
              "value": "Discontinued",
              "url": "/python/html5/menu_attr_pair/1000/215000/menu_attr_pair_qtyInStock_Discontinued_1_7d8925edfb.html"
            }
          ],
          "name_url": "/python/html5/menu_attr_pair/1000/215000/menu_attr_pair_qtyInStock_Discontinued_1_7d8925edfb.html"
        },
        {
          "name": "SKU",
          "values": [
            {
              "value": "SWA0953D",
              "url": "/python/html5/menu_attr_pair/1000/2000000/2287000/menu_attr_pair_SKU_SWA0953D_1_0cc2982c54.html"
            }
          ],
          "name_url": "/python/html5/menu_attr_pair/1000/2000000/2287000/menu_attr_pair_SKU_SWA0953D_1_0cc2982c54.html"
        },
        {
          "name": "Colour Description",
          "values": [
            {
              "value": "Black",
              "url": "/python/html5/menu_attr_pair/1000/2000000/2287000/menu_attr_pair_ColourDescription_Black_1_66066088ab.html"
            }
          ],
          "name_url": "/python/html5/menu_attr_pair/1000/2000000/2287000/menu_attr_pair_ColourDescription_Black_1_66066088ab.html"
        },
        {
          "name": "Additional Features",
          "values": [
            {
              "value": "Adjustable",
              "url": "/python/html5/menu_attr_pair/1000/2000000/2286000/menu_attr_pair_AdditionalFeatures_Adjustable_1_2742a00940.html"
            }
          ],
          "name_url": "/python/html5/menu_attr_pair/1000/2000000/2286000/menu_attr_pair_AdditionalFeatures_Adjustable_1_2742a00940.html"
        },
        {
          "name": "Certification",
          "values": [
            {
              "value": "No",
              "url": "/python/html5/menu_attr_pair/1000/2000000/2286000/menu_attr_pair_Certification_No_1_939db8cca4.html"
            }
          ],
          "name_url": "/python/html5/menu_attr_pair/1000/2000000/2286000/menu_attr_pair_Certification_No_1_939db8cca4.html"
        },
        {
          "name": "Lockable",
          "values": [
            {
              "value": "No",
              "url": "/python/html5/menu_attr_pair/1000/2000000/2286000/menu_attr_pair_Lockable_No_1_dbc98bfb9d.html"
            }
          ],
          "name_url": "/python/html5/menu_attr_pair/1000/2000000/2286000/menu_attr_pair_Lockable_No_1_dbc98bfb9d.html"
        },
        {
          "name": "Made in Canada",
          "values": [
            {
              "value": "No",
              "url": "/python/html5/menu_attr_pair/1000/2000000/2287000/menu_attr_pair_MadeinCanada_No_1_360a376c07.html"
            }
          ],
          "name_url": "/python/html5/menu_attr_pair/1000/2000000/2287000/menu_attr_pair_MadeinCanada_No_1_360a376c07.html"
        },
        {
          "name": "Type",
          "values": [
            {
              "value": "Messenger Bag",
              "url": "/python/html5/menu_attr_pair/1000/2000000/2287000/menu_attr_pair_Type_MessengerBag_1_dd6de0822a.html"
            }
          ],
          "name_url": "/python/html5/menu_attr_pair/1000/2000000/2287000/menu_attr_pair_Type_MessengerBag_1_dd6de0822a.html"
        },
        {
          "name": "Dimensions",
          "values": [
            {
              "value": "14&quot;W x 2 1/2&quot;D x 10 1/2&quot;H",
              "url": "/python/html5/menu_attr_pair/1000/2000000/2287000/menu_attr_pair_Dimensions_14quotWx212quotDx1012quotH_1_a6dfb9671d.html"
            }
          ],
          "name_url": "/python/html5/menu_attr_pair/1000/2000000/2287000/menu_attr_pair_Dimensions_14quotWx212quotDx1012quotH_1_a6dfb9671d.html"
        },
        {
          "name": "Primary Colour",
          "values": [
            {
              "value": "Black",
              "url": "/python/html5/menu_attr_pair/1000/2000000/2287000/menu_attr_pair_PrimaryColour_Black_1_ff028cdde6.html"
            }
          ],
          "name_url": "/python/html5/menu_attr_pair/1000/2000000/2287000/menu_attr_pair_PrimaryColour_Black_1_ff028cdde6.html"
        },
        {
          "name": "Warranty",
          "values": [
            {
              "value": "5-year limited manufacturer&#39;s warranty",
              "url": "/python/html5/menu_attr_pair/1000/2000000/2287000/menu_attr_pair_Warranty_5yearlimitedmanufacturer39swarranty_1_bb4d9a58fc.html"
            }
          ],
          "name_url": "/python/html5/menu_attr_pair/1000/2000000/2287000/menu_attr_pair_Warranty_5yearlimitedmanufacturer39swarranty_1_bb4d9a58fc.html"
        },
        {
          "name": "Recycled Content",
          "values": [
            {
              "value": "No",
              "url": "/python/html5/menu_attr_pair/1000/2000000/2287000/menu_attr_pair_RecycledContent_No_1_bfc263ad82.html"
            }
          ],
          "name_url": "/python/html5/menu_attr_pair/1000/2000000/2287000/menu_attr_pair_RecycledContent_No_1_bfc263ad82.html"
        },
        {
          "name": "Style",
          "values": [
            {
              "value": "Top-Loading",
              "url": "/python/html5/menu_attr_pair/1000/2000000/2287000/menu_attr_pair_Style_TopLoading_1_2c82bcba5c.html"
            }
          ],
          "name_url": "/python/html5/menu_attr_pair/1000/2000000/2287000/menu_attr_pair_Style_TopLoading_1_2c82bcba5c.html"
        }
      ],
      "images": [],
      "distributors": [
        {
          "name": "Grand and Toy",
          "sku": "SWA0953D",
          "url": "https://www.grandandtoy.com/en/product/SWA0953D_SwissGear_Top-Loading_Black_Messenger_Bag.aspx",
          "pricing": [],
          "stock": {
            "available": false,
            "quantity": null,
            "lead_time_days": null
          },
          "moq": 1,
          "multiple": 1,
          "image": "https://www.dataalchemy.com/python/getu/c1dd5196-208f-4a93-b221-defb4448c570"
        }
      ],
      "amazon": {
        "available": false,
        "products": []
      },
      "metadata": {
        "generated_date": "2026-04-25",
        "last_updated": "2026-04-25",
        "data_sources": [
          "Grand and Toy"
        ],
        "completeness": 0.75,
        "version": "1.2"
      }
    }
  },
  "pagination": null,
  "nav": {
    "home": "/python/html5/index.html",
    "brands": "/python/html5/menu_brand_index/menu_brand_index_brands_87101ba214.html",
    "parts": "/python/html5/menu_part_index/menu_part_index_parts_909e6bf0ca.html",
    "attributes": "/python/html5/menu_attr_index/menu_attr_index_attributes_d7f67a250d.html"
  }
}